hi,to pass the sva test do i need a handbrake warning lamp,and do i also need a low brake fluid level warning lamp,if i need both could i have them going to the same warning lamp,any idea,s,cheers
limpabit
24th September 2009, 05:39
Hi.
Yes you only need one lamp to do the both for the SVA. Think only difference with the IVA (sva's replacement), is that you need a sticker near the master brake cylinder with the type of brake fluid being used.
